>Roland,
>
>Try this by setting up environment variables at the top of your script:
>
>SERVER1= 10.10.10.10
>USER1= 'xxx'
>PWD1= 'xxx'
>SERVER2= 10.10.10.20
>USER1= 'yyy'
>PWD2= 'yyyy'
>
>Then have this:
>
>ftp -i -n << EOF
>open $SERVER1
>user $USER1 $PWD1
>cd scripts
>get <file>
>close
>EOF
>
>You can then have a section like the one below if you want to copy to a
>different server
>other than the one you are running this script from:
>
>ftp -i -n << EOF
>open $SERVER2
>user $USER2 $PWD2
>cd scripts
>put <file>
>close
>EOF
>
>Both of these can be included in the one shell script.

>Hallo,
>
>I would like to have an example of a unix script, which does the following:
>
>copy some files from directory /prod/sas/data located at "hardy".(which is
>a computer)
>to the other database hakon. Is it possible to do this. Please help me
>quick.
